DigiTickets is a leading provider of software solutions for the visitor attraction and hospitality sector, helping our clients to increase revenue, streamline operations, and improve the visitor experience through innovative technology.
As we continue to grow, we're looking for a Senior Front End Developer to help shape and contribute to our portfolio of SaaS products.
Benefits
Holidays: 25-30 days of annual leave (plus bank holidays), with increased entitlement based on service.
Competitive Salary: Up £56k
Nest Pension scheme
Discretionary company bonus
Annual Training Allowance: Receive support for certifications and professional development.
Birthday Leave: Enjoy a day off on your birthday to celebrate.
Team Events: Be part of a collaborative and social team culture.
Hybrid Working options.

Requirements
~1 min readGood knowledge of building responsive, progressive web applications
Working with modern JavaScript frameworks
Experience with SCSS or Tailwind CSS framework
H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ript, TypeScript
Experience with cross-browser and cross-device testing
Using JavaScript asset-building pipelines (eg, Webpack, Gulp, etc)
Front-End testing frameworks (Jest, Cypress) and methodologies (TDD, BDD)
Knowledge of version control systems (Git)
Understanding of software design patterns
Highly organised with strong attention to detail.
